Dodge is undoubtedly an American make of automobile manufactured by FCA US LLC (formerly often known as Chrysler Group LLC), headquartered in Auburn Hills, Michigan. Dodge vehicles currently range from the lower-priced badge variants of Chrysler-badged vehicles in addition to performance cars, though for a great deal of its existence Dodge was Chrysler's mid-priced brand above Plymouth.Founded as being the Dodge Brothers Company machine shop by brothers Horace Elgin Dodge and John Francis Dodge noisy . 1900s,[3] Dodge was originally a supplier of parts and assemblies for Detroit-based automakers and began building complete automobiles within the "Dodge Brothers" brand in 1914, predating the founding of Chrysler Corporation. The factory was situated in Hamtramck, Michigan, and was referred to as Dodge Main factory from 1910 until its closing in January 1980. The Dodge brothers both died in 1920, along with the company was sold by their own families to Dillon, Read & Co. in 1925 before being sold to Chrysler in 1928. Dodge vehicles mainly was comprised of trucks and full-sized passenger cars over the 1970s, even though it made memorable compact cars (such as being the 1963–76 Dart) and midsize cars (such as being the "B-Body" Coronet and Charger from 1962–79).The 1973 oil crisis and its particular subsequent effect on the American automobile industry led Chrysler to cultivate the K platform of compact to midsize cars to the 1981 model year. The K platform as well as derivatives are credited with reviving Chrysler's business within the 1980s; the type of derivative was crowned the Dodge Caravan.The Dodge brand has withstood the multiple ownership changes at Chrysler from 1998 to 2009, including its short-lived merger with Daimler-Benz AG from 1998 to 2007, its subsequent sale to Cerberus Capital Management, its 2009 bailout because of the United States government, as well as its subsequent Chapter 11 bankruptcy and acquisition by Fiat.In 2011, Dodge, Ram, and Dodge's Viper were separated. Dodge declared the Dodge Viper could well be an SRT product and Ram might be a manufacturer. In 2014, SRT was merged into Dodge. Later that year, Chrysler Group was renamed FCA US LLC, corresponding with all the merger of Fiat S.p.A. and Chrysler Group in the single corporate structure of Fiat Chrysler Automobiles.
